The domes exterior is steel reinforced concrete with a 225 mph wind and F4 warranty from American Ingenuity (Ai) who has been in business for over 40 years. The domes were built from Aidome building kits.


    1,075 sq.ft. 34 foot in diameter Aidome Home has two bedrooms and two baths (first floor 819; second floor 256) linked to a one car 22 foot in diameter garage dome via a covered 36 sq.ft. walkway. Dome home sets on .27 acre corner lot with full unobstructed view of the Indian River with semi-circular driveway. Sidewalk with 25 foot in diameter concrete patio. Home features kitchen island, high vaulted ceilings, two high profile entryways and fenced yard. All glass is double paned. Great for a primary home, retirement home or vacation home.


    Garage has 375 sq.ft. with 88 sq.ft. of attic storage above the one car parking. Garage dome has rear door dormer to access the back yard. There is ample space around the first floor perimeter for storage. There is a laundry tub and toilet in the garage. Sears garage door opener. Garage door is 7’ tall and 9’ wide. Patio slab 25 feet in diameter.



    • The exterior of the domes is concrete reinforced with galvanized steel mesh and fibers. The domes were built from building kits manufactured by American Ingenuity. To view a summary on advantages of the Aidome, click Summary. There is no wood in or on the exterior dome walls or roof. No wood to burn, no wood for termites to eat and no wood to interrupt the insulation. There is only pressure treated wood to frame in around exterior doors and windows.

    • American Ingenuity gives a warranty of 225 mph wind and F4 tornado on the exterior dome panels against structural damage due to winds for ten years. The warranty does not include the exterior framed walls, exterior doors/windows, interior items or life and limb. The warranty is not transferable. In the above photo gallery, there is a picture of a dumpster containing roofing from a neighbor’s house when Hurricane Jeanne ripped the roof off the neighbors house. There was no damage to the concrete dome.

    • The exterior has no roof to replace every 11-12 years. The exterior concrete is painted with elastomeric paint.

    • The exterior wall has seven inch thick modified expanded polystyrene insulation (R28). This means the exterior walls and roof have the same composition. Because the dome has 30% less exterior surface area, the insulation is R28 and is not interrupted by wood, the cooling and heating bills are low. I can cool the 1,075 dome home for less than $27 a month in the hot Florida Summer Months. 76 degrees when home and 79 degrees when not home. The dome is an all-electric house.     Why Purchase a Home Built From an Aidome?


    The geodesic dome was built from an American Ingenuity (Ai) dome building kit which consists of prefabricated triangle shaped panels and four foot tall riser panels. The dome’s exterior is fire resistant concrete reinforced with galvanized steel mesh and fibers. Its insulation is R28 . The dome panels contain no wood to interrupt the insulation, no wood for termites to eat and no wood to burn. There is no roof to replace every 11-12 years. The dome’s exterior walls are incredibly strong, resist tree impact and resist forest fires due to non-combustible concrete exterior. The insulation results in the dome’s cooling and heating costs being 50% to 60% lower than a box shaped house.


    Why is a Geodesic Dome So Strong?


    Geodesic domes are three-dimensional structures using stable triangles approximating spheres to create multiple load carrying paths from point of load to point of support. The triangle is the only arrangement of structural members that is stable within itself without requiring additional connections at the intersection points to prevent warping of the geometry. In other words, apply pressure to one edge of a triangle, and that force is evenly distributed to the other two sides, which then transmit pressure to adjacent triangles. That cascading distribution of pressure is how geodesic domes efficiently distribute stress along the entire structure, much like the shell of an egg.
